Care Management - LVN, Senior Blue Shield of CA United States, California, Lodi Jun 13, 2026 Your Role The Care Management team will serve to support the mission of the department, which is to provide support to patients in maintaining health and wellness in the outpatient setting. The Senior LVN, Care Manager will report to the Manager of Care Management. In this role you will work in the Outreach and Enrollment department, and play a pivotal role in reaching out to our members, assessing their needs, and providing comprehensive care coordination. This position requires a proactive individual who can successfully engage and connect members to appropriate health programs and resources. Your Knowledge and Experience Requires a current CA LVN License
Certificate/diploma in vocational nursing required or advanced degree preferred
Certified Case Manager (CCM) Certification or is in process of completing certification when eligible based on CCM application requirements
Requires at least 5 years of prior experience in nursing, healthcare or related field
A minimum of 3 years' experience in inpatient, outpatient, and/or managed care environment required
Health insurance/managed care experience is preferred
Excellent communications skills
Bilingual is preferred
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to engage and build rapport with diverse populations
Demonstrated ability to independently assess, evaluate, and interpret clinical information Hybrid Virtual Work
This role allows employees to work virtually full-time, however employees will be expected to come to the office based on business need.
